Output 6354f59ef89bca20d17199dbb3833858e6dcbb9a005fb4c50a300a40da1edcb6:8

value
60000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f57743f86c6824711726a1741e665a5478d97ef OP_EQUAL
address
38vY57eKS8b9JsLw4oJRcWgAwAzQY3bkba
transaction
6354f59ef89bca20d17199dbb3833858e6dcbb9a005fb4c50a300a40da1edcb6
confirmations
307156
spent
true